CORVALLIS, Ore. (AP) -Oregon State forward Marcel Jones plans to make himself available for the NBA draft but will not hire an agent.
The 6-foot-8 junior will likely return for his senior season, but would like to “test the waters and see what happens,” he said in a statement released by the school Thursday.
Jones led the Beavers in scoring last season by averaging 15.3 points. He also averaged 7.9 rebounds and 1.5 steals.
“It’s a dream of everybody that plays college sports to further their careers professionally,” Jones said. “If I don’t stay in the draft, then when I come back to OSU I know people will have raised expectations for me. I’ll come back a better player and ready to make us a better team.”
Jones won’t take classes this spring because of the draft, so he must take summer courses to remain eligible.
